The Bosch Rexroth Indramat MAC090C-0-KD-4-C/110-A-0/WI522LX from the MAC AC Servo Motors series showcases a robust family MAC design with a centering diameter of 110 mm and plain output shaft on side A. This 090 size code servomotor features electronic commutation and a KD winding type for precise control under varying loads. With standard speed of 2000 min-1 and a total mass of 23 kg, it delivers stable operation without a blocking brake, as its blocking brake: No specification confirms. The motor housing integrates shaft sealing to protect internal components and supports both horizontal and vertical mounting orientations.
Engineered for natural cooling, this drive relies on natural convection to dissipate heat during continuous operation and withstands ambient temperatures from 0 °C to 45 °C. Separate flanged sockets for power and feedback connections use spigot nuts for secure terminations, while incremental encoder feedback integrates tacho signals for high-resolution rotor position sensing. The unit endures radial and axial forces encountered in transfer systems and robotics without derating, and its low-inertia rotor enables rapid accelerations and decelerations.
Installation follows either Design B5 or Design B14 flange standards and mandates proper grounding to the servo amplifier.
